Study Of Routing Technologies In Hybrid SDN Network

Network has been the most import infrastructure resource,as the demand and scale has been rapidly expanding.On one hand network reasearchers are encouraged to create new network architecture and protocols.On the other hand because of current network is complexed and closed,today there is almost no practical way for researchers to experiment with new network protocols.For sloving various issues in TCP/IP network,researchers propose the definition of SDN(Software Defined Network).SDN dissociated network configuration from embedded network devices,dividing network into software-based network controller and action-based forwarding devices.Under this architecture,all network resource could be configured and managed by the controller.OpenFlow is a product protocol suits of Software Defined Network.As the forwarding device defined by SDN is totally different from current network devices,which makes difficulty for current network and software defined network coexist.This difference blocks the development of SDN.Aim at sloving this issue,this paper focus on some key technologies used in deploying SDN in current network.Based on these technologies and open source openflow controller-Floodlight,this paper implements the corresponding system,which named Enhanced SDN Routing System.This Enhanced SDN Routing System brings routing capacity into OpenFlow network,making a SDN network could commiucate routing protocol with current network routing device(et router).Then this two different type of network could be connected.As a addon,this paper will propose a way to dynamically manage flow path in openflow network,which make a more blanced network cost and improve the link bandwidth utilization.The first two chapter of this paper describe the background of SDN.The third and forth chapter proposed the requirements,key technologies scheme in hybird SDN environment and Enhanced SDN Routing System design in detail.The fifth chapter by means of different function validate experiment,we prove that this Enhanced SDN Routing System will slove issues in mixed SDN environment.The last chapter summarize this paper and discuss the related work in future.
